WebSouthern Homestyle Gourmet Peanuts are hand-picked from the region’s finest extra large Virginia-type peanuts. Our “blister roast” recipe has been used by farm families to cook peanuts in their home kitchens for generations. The peanuts are first water-blanched, then small batch roasted in pure peanut oil to develop their crunchiness.
